搜尋

首頁  >  問答  >  主體

javascript - 這個內容分塊顯示是怎麼實現的,為什麼我測試不行

這個單頁是怎麼實現的分塊顯示內容的

我把它的

<script type="text/javascript" src="http://ajax.microsoft.com/ajax/jquery/jquery-1.4.2.min.js"></script>
<script>
$(function(){
    $("#nav a").click(function(){
        href = $(this).attr('href');
        if (href.slice(0, 1)=='#') {
            type = href.slice(1);
            $(".content").fadeOut(350);
            $("#content-" + type).fadeIn(350);
        }
    });
});
</script>
<style>

.content {
    padding-left: 20px;
    display: none;
    position: absolute;
    top: 0;
    left: 0;
}
</style>

這兩塊拿了下來,
然後我的設定是這樣設定的
導航

<p id="nav" style="margin-bottom:20px">
    <a href="#product-jichu" class="summary current">基本信息</a>
    <a href="#product-canshu" class="desc">详情</a>
    <a href="#product-pinglun" class="review">评价</a>

</p>

內容

<p class="content" id="content-product-info" style="display:block;">
测试页面1
</p>
<p class="content" id="content-product-canshu">
测试页面2
</p>
<p class="content" id="content-product-pinglun">
测试页面3
</p>

為什麼這樣不能跟他一樣的效果,
我這裡就打開的時候顯示了一下,然後點擊導航之後全部都不顯示了,哪裡沒寫對嗎

曾经蜡笔没有小新曾经蜡笔没有小新2757 天前387

全部回覆(2)我來回復

  • 漂亮男人

    漂亮男人2017-05-16 13:18:49

    測驗頁1的id後綴和a裡面的不一致

    回覆
    0
  • 黄舟

    黄舟2017-05-16 13:18:49

    好吧,還是自己的問題,script裡面的content又不知道為什麼被程式吞了

    回覆
    0
  • 取消回覆